After I had completed the session yesterday gnucash loaded andd I was  
able to load up data from my server, all seemed well. Today I have  
tried to run gnucash and I get the splash screen but then it hangs at  
the 'loading data...' screen.

I have noticed that the shell environment variables are not being set  
by my ~/.profile but there is neither a ~/.bash_login or a  
~/.bash_profile in my home directory. Even if I set the PATH  
environment manually to:

export PATH=/opt/local/bin:/opt/local/sbin:$PATH

and check that it is working I still get gnucash hanging at the same  
point. I have tried renaming the .gnucash file to .gnucash_old to see  
if it was some setting that was screwing up the loading but I just  
get the same result.

Any ideas?
